what is frog spawn??

ANSWER:Frogspawn is a soft substance like jelly which contains the eggs of a frog

it's function is

The frogspawn that you see floating in ponds is made up of thousands of single eggs, each one having a tiny black tadpole embryo surrounded in jelly. ... At first each tadpole embryo will eat the jelly that is around it until it is ready to hatch.
